Tips to Lower Your Insurance in White Rock

Bundle your auto and home insurance with one provider — most insurers in British Columbia offer 10–15% multi-policy discounts.

Install a monitored alarm or telematics device. Insurers reward lower-risk behaviour with reduced premiums.

Maintain a clean driving record. Even one at-fault accident can raise your White Rock auto premium significantly.

Increase your deductible if you can comfortably absorb more out-of-pocket in a claim — it lowers your annual premium.

Compare quotes at renewal time every year. Loyalty discounts are often smaller than new-customer rates from competitors.

Ask about all available discounts: winter tire credits, claims-free discounts, alumni/group discounts, and new home discounts.

Is home insurance mandatory in White Rock?

Home insurance is not legally required in British Columbia, but your mortgage lender will almost certainly require it as a condition of your mortgage. Even without a mortgage, home insurance in White Rock protects against significant financial loss from fire, theft, liability, water damage, and weather events.
